Position Responsibilities:
- Creates measurement plans from engineering drawings that use photogrammetry, laser trackers, articulating arms, or other metrology 3-D instruments to measure assemblies and subassemblies
- Uses computer-aided designs (CAD) graphic user interface software for design
- Set up and operate 3-D metrology instruments to check overall and detailed alignment, fit, or adjustment of assemblies
- Develop training for performing 3-D measurements
- Devises and implements methods and procedures for inspecting, testing, and evaluating the precision and accuracy of products
- Performs statistical analysis to assess, characterize, control, and manage risks of product quality and associated use conditions and non-conformances
- Ensures that corrective measures and deviations meet acceptable reliability standards and that documentation is compliant with requirements
- Perform root cause analysis of incidents requiring corrective action
